- [ ] Step 7: Archive cold storage buckets (Glacierline tier). Confirm both ceremony witnesses are present, verify bucket manifests match the Oxbow ledger, then seal the archive key shares. Plugin authors may observe but not handle shares. Once sealed, the archive index itself is encrypted and can only be reopened with the passphrase below.

vault phrase of badup-hahig = tamael-aldael-kelmir-istael-fenok-istwyn-tamius-jorath-oliion

## Onboarding: Farebranch Rules Engine

Plugin authors integrate with Farebranch by registering fee rules against the evaluation API. Rules are sandboxed; they cannot perform network calls directly. All rate-table lookups go through the host, which validates your plugin manifest at load time. Your local env file must include the signing credential the host uses to verify manifests, set on the next line.

secret setting of bajef-fajof: COURIER_KEY3=76c

Runbook: Account Recovery — Duskfall Retention Sweeper. Scope: contractor access to the sweeper admin account. The sweeper purges records past retention windows nightly; if its service account locks out, purge jobs stall and storage alarms fire within 48h. Steps: confirm lockout in the Harrowgate console, file an access ticket, then run the recovery flow from a bastion host. The flow prompts for the recovery passphrase shown below.

vault phrase of tawig-taduf = zorath-oliwyn

The Striderly chip-reader API exposes three endpoints: /reads (raw chip crossings), /splits (computed segment times), and /health. Poll /health every 30s during race windows; anything above 500ms latency means the mat controllers are backed up. All endpoints require a bearer token issued by the internal Striderly auth service. Tokens do not expire mid-event but are rotated weekly. If reads stall, restart the ingest daemon before escalating. Authenticate your curl checks with the key that follows.

API key for yahig-tadup: kto7_ubizbYm